JLLX Rockwell Apartments, DST reached full cycle on April 17, 2024. That day, JLL Income Property Trust announced three additional DST full-cycle UPREIT acquisitions from the JLL Exchange (JLLX) platform, covering seven properties in all.
The release describes the mechanism: in a 721 UPREIT transaction, real estate is exchanged on a tax-deferred basis for partnership interests in a REIT. How that treatment applies to a particular holder depends on that holder's own facts.

Between that filing and the announcement lies a hold of 2.5 years, computed from the two dates.
One point about the identification belongs on the record. The release, both on JLL Income Property Trust's site and in the PR Newswire version, names neither the three trusts nor the seven properties, so which property belonged to which program is not stated in it. Top1031 records this Trust as having gone full cycle in that announcement on two bases: The Rockwell appears in the REIT's multifamily portfolio, and the property was part of the April 17, 2024 announcement.
No disposition value, total return, annualized return, or equity multiple for this Trust appears in the announcement. The private placement memorandum, where the offering's distribution terms are set out, was not filed publicly, and the Form D carries no performance figures.
